BVI House Asia's BVI Christmas Carnival In Hong Kong

Monday, 9 December 2019 - 1:27pm

On the evening of December 5, BVI House Asia hosted its annual end of year event under the theme “BVI Festival for Christmas,” to celebrate the close of the year and thank the Financial Services Industry for its ongoing support of the British Virgin Islands as a jurisdiction. The widely attended event was hosted by outgoing Director, Mrs. Sherri Ortiz, and incoming Director, Dr. Ricardo Wheatley at the world class Murray Hotel in Central Hong Kong.  More than 140 guests and friends from the Financial Services Industry were in attendance, as well as a VIP delegation from the British Virgin Islands Government including the Hon Vincent Wheatley (Deputy Premier and Minster of Natural Resources & Labour), Dr. Cassandra Titley-O'Neal (Director of National Parks Trust of the Virgin Islands), and Ms. Lynette Harrigan, (Niche Marketing Manager of the BVI Tourist Board).

BVI House Asia Visited by the BVI’s Mrs. Globe

Thursday, 5 December 2019 - 5:09pm

On December 2, BVI House Asia hosted an in-house visit by the BVI’s Mrs. Globe International Pageant delegation, led by former Mrs. BVI Globe Alicia Green now BVI Director, as they transited to mainland China through the city of Hong Kong to attend the competition. Mrs. British Virgin Islands, Shondrea N. Turnbull, is representing the BVI in the 2019 edition of the Mrs. Globe International Pageant (November 29-December 7), hosted by the Southern Chinese tech-city of Shenzhen. The delegation, comprised of friends, family, and government officials travelled to China in support of Shondrea’s bid for the crown.
